Quick definitions and best-use highlights for each format.
DOCX is Microsoft's Word document format. It keeps structure and basic formatting so you can edit, comment, and share transcripts.
View DOCX guidePDF is a fixed-layout document format. It preserves the transcript's appearance so it looks the same everywhere.
View PDF guideBest for
Editing, revisions, and collaboration
Avoid when
Final distribution where layout must not change
Best for
Sharing, archiving, and printing
Avoid when
Heavy edits or iterative changes
